IT ETHICAL DILEMMA/EARLY LAUNCHQ1. What's going on?The main aspect, which is seen in the scenario, which is chosen, is that a projectwould be delivered to the client without any sort of encryption involved into it. The mainrecommendation of the aspect is coming from the end of the project manager. On the otherhand it can be stated according to the scenario is that the project director seems not be somuch interested into the event. This is due to the factor that if the software is launchedwithout any encryption process involved into it, it can have different types of securityimplications, which could lead to different types of problem, involved in it. Q2. What are the facts?The facts which are seen in the scenario is that the process of encryption is beingavoided in the case of the early launch of the software. The main aspects which are noticedrelating to the early launch is that on one hand the software would not incorporate theencryption but it is stated that later on a patch or software update would be launched whichwould fix the problem. And on the other ahdn the early launch of the software would makethe project director eligible for bonus which is one of the main factors which sis consideredIn the scenario. Q3. What are the issues?The main issue, which is seen from the scenario, is that a project without properencryption process is being delivered to the client. The proposal of doing so came from theproject manager. According to the project manager, the delivery of the software without anyproper encryption would not lead to any type of problem, as they would be incorporating anupdate later on, which would consist all the necessary aspects of the security. Who is affected?The sector, which would be affected if the event of launching the software takesplace, would be both the organization who is manufacturing it as well as the organizationwho would be using or implementing the software. Technically stating if a software islaunched without proper encryption involved into it the hackers can easily access the data orthe information, which would be contained in the software. The process of encryption can beconsidered as one of the most important security aspects, which should always be highlyrecommended in any type of software. This concept should be of upmost priority being that ifany leakage of information is done from the software. Q5. What are the ethical issues and their implications?The main ethical issue, which is being seen in the scenario, is that any softwarewithout security implications involved into it can be very much unethical aspect. This is dueto the factor that it could directly allow the hackers to indulge into retrieval of the data, whichis stored in the system. The data of any organization can be considered very much critical andif the any another person except the authorized person get access to the data, it could lead toproblem for the organization. Most of the critical information of the data relating to thefinancial and other critical sector are saved in the database of the software, if this type ofcritical information goes into the hand of hackers or unauthorized person it can be a huge lossfrom the point of view of the business.
